OK State of play.

I was added a simple new feature to the main site when I accidentally deleted the whole of the main database. Thats BAD.

Good news is I have backups - bad news is I can't get at them as they are not in my control. I am currently chasing the hosts. If it takes much longer I'll restore a manual backup as a stop gap. I have one but its about a month old, so don't be surprised if recent things don't appear there.

More info when I know more.

Chris.

18:36hrs Current status.

I could bring the site back now, BUT

The last full working backup database I've managed to get to work from scratch is dated 8th of may [:'(] - All I've managed to get off the later databases backups so far is the user table - ie all registered users and subscribers to the time of the problem. (If this table had gone for good - it would have caused major major problems)

That said, none of the uploaded photos have been lost at all right up to this morning, but in the worse case you might have to save them to your machine and then reupload them (interestingly enough on this - I've noticed that if I do this you will be able to access all the pictures you've uploaded ever - even if you thought you had deleted them - I got a bit lost down memory lane for a bit when I saw what was in my folder)

Trades: I'm thinking now might be a good time to wipe the slate and start again, a lot of the stuff in there was very old, (and causing some problems with people finding things that were deleted) and the change I was making was related to improved handling of the trades section. I know this is a bit of a pain for those that uploaded recently but if it comes to it I will waiver the 30 days rule and you can enter again immediately. (Anyone linking to any pictures remotely like from ebay, will still be ok and the pictures should show)

So the big losses at the moment that I am still working on is

- model comments, no sign of those posted since the 8th of may yet, same for movie comments (but again the movie files themselves are safe)

Showroom entries - pictures are fine but the actual data/text is still AWOL.

Unfortunately I can't bring the database back as it stands, if there is chance I can still recover more data. If I make it live and then people use it then it makes it impossible to restore any more data.

Its going to be a long night.

Chris
